The intent of this notice is to determine the availability of business to provide for the creation and publication of five online illustrated essays relating to the history and significance of historic Reclamation resources, located in Washington State, in fulfillment of stipulations from previously created agreement documents. The work will include research, the production of a draft and final version of the illustrated essay, and the publication of that final version of the essay on a publicly accessible website, for long-term availability.
